Cannabis with an estimated street value of £150,000 has been discovered at a property in Fleetwood.
Yesterday evening (Tuesday 7th November 2023), Fleetwood Neighbourhood Policing Team were proactively patrolling anti-social behaviour hotspots. Officers noticed significant electrical wiring near a group of properties, and a strong smell of cannabis, on Victoria Street.
Upon entering a property, officers found a cannabis grow with over 100 plants inside.
The plants have an estimated value of up to £150,000.
Due to concerns with the electricity, Electricity North West attended the property to make the area safe.
No arrests have been made and enquiries are ongoing.
